Red Barn Radio showcases Old Time and Bluegrass musicians, both from our Commonwealth and neighboring states where Kentucky music has settled and flourished. In weekly conversation and performance with our talented guests, Red Barn Radio enlivens and archives Kentucky’s musical heritage, and brings to the airwaves a uniquely refreshing and folksy hour of Americana programming.
